如何在不同的操作系统上设置 HOSTS 文件?

Bri*_*tle 7 networking domain-name-system hosts multi-platform

请提供示例说明如何在各种操作系统的客户端和服务器版本上进行设置。

cha*_*aos 12

Linux/Unix 上的主机文件:

/etc/hosts

ip.nu.mb.er   name1 name2
Run Code Online (Sandbox Code Playgroud)

Windows 上的主机文件:

%WINDOWS%\System32\Drivers\etc\hosts (e.g. C:\Windows\System32\Drivers\etc\hosts)

ip.nu.mb.er   name1 name2
Run Code Online (Sandbox Code Playgroud)


Sör*_*lau 5

假设您询问如何找到该文件(它很可能已经存在):

  • 在类 Unix 操作系统(包括 Mac OS X 和 Linux)中,您通常会hosts/etc/hosts. 请注意,默认情况下 Mac OS X 不会向您显示etc目录。您可以通过多种方式显示它,例如选择Go ? 前往Finder 中的文件夹...,然后输入/etc.
  • 在基于 NT 的操作系统(包括 Windows XP 和 Windows Vista)中,该etc目录略微隐藏%WINDIR%\system32\drivers\,例如C:\WINDOWS\system32\drivers\etc\hosts.